October: Post-season eligible

On the 40-man before noon ET Sep 1. He stays eligible as long as he remains on the 40-man or 60-day IL through the post-season; an outright after the cutoff would end automatic eligibility.

The post-season eligibility list is fixed at noon ET on September 1: everyone on the 40-man, the 60-day IL or the military list at that moment, who then stays there without interruption. Attachment 25 (Major League Rule 40)

What happens if the club…

option him to the minorsBLOCKED
Not without his consent: with five years of service he can refuse the assignment or elect free agency instead. The club's only unilateral moves are to keep him, trade him, or release him.
Article XIX-A: five years, no forced assignment
designate him for assignment (or put him on outright waivers)
The club has 7 days to trade him, pass him through outright waivers, or release him; he is paid at the major-league rate and keeps accruing service in the meantime. On outright waivers any club can claim him for $50,000, worst record first, and the claiming club takes his contract (8 yr, $106.75M (2023-30), 2031 club option). If he clears, he cannot be outrighted without his consent: he can refuse and force a release with his contract intact, or elect free agency (forfeiting termination pay). Post-season: an outright after the September 1 cutoff ends his automatic eligibility. He could only return as an approved injury replacement, and only if he accepts the outright and stays on a minor-league reserve list in the organization without interruption; a release makes him ineligible for anyone this October. With real money left on the contract a claim is unlikely; the usual outcome is clearing waivers, then release, with the club paying the balance less what a new club pays him.
Designated for assignment: 7 days · Outright waivers · Article XIX-A: five years, no forced outright
release him
Release waivers cost a claiming club $1 but the claimant assumes the whole contract, so expensive players clear. The club owes the full unpaid balance of this season's salary, offset by whatever another club pays him this year. The guaranteed years remain owed in full. A released player is not post-season eligible for any club this year.

trade himBLOCKED
Not now: players on major-league contracts cannot be traded after the Aug 3 deadline until the day after the World Series.

Let the season end
Under contract (8 yr, $106.75M (2023-30), 2031 club option): nothing to decide this winter. Moving him later means trading the contract or releasing him and paying the guaranteed years in full.
